怎样在Excel中实现在一个单元格填了内容另一个单元格会根据前面所填的内容自动变更?

就像这样A增加,B减少,C是自动生成的结果

第1个回答  2013-07-28
C1可手工填写一下,也可用公式 =IF(B1<>" ",A1-B1)
在C2中输入公式 =IF(B2<>" ",C1+A2-B2,C1+A2),一拉得。
第2个回答  2013-07-28
C1输入公式=A1-B1
C2输入公式=A2-B2+C1追问

我是要设置了 以后直接在A和B中输入数字C就可以自动生成结果的 不是这种每次都要我自己输公式的

追答

C2公式改成=IF(AND(A2="",B2=""),"",A2-B2+C1)先下拉N行。

不用你每次输入公式,这个公式多拉几行就行了。

追问

可是可以了   但是为什么下拉后   拉过的地方都是一片空白

追答

因为你下面还没输入数字啊,所以是空白的,如果想没输入数字还显示的话,要用原来的=A2-B2+C1

本回答被提问者采纳
第3个回答  2013-07-28
c1中输入=a1 +b1,=表示输入的是公式a1,b1表示引用单元格。
第4个回答  2013-07-28
在C选定公式就行